Essay Topics

Write an essay for ONE of the following topics:

Essay Topic 1

Many events in this book are historical and are only slightly fictionalized to include Hornblower in them. What are some of these events, and how does knowing they are real history change the tone and feeling of these scenes.

Essay Topic 2

Despair is a theme that appears in a number of sensitive places in this plot. What are some of these places, and what role does despair play in this novel?

Essay Topic 3

Valor is a theme of this book that is very important to many of the characters involved. Where does this theme of valor present itself and how do these occurrences affect the characters involved in those scenes?
